|
|
@@ -17,7 +17,7 @@ |
|
|
|
<ul class="lr-left-list" id="lr_left_list"> |
|
|
|
<li data-value="1">基本信息</li> |
|
|
|
@*<li data-value="2">联系方式</li>*@ |
|
|
|
<li data-value="3">我的头像</li> |
|
|
|
@*<li data-value="3">我的头像</li>*@ |
|
|
|
<li data-value="4">修改密码</li> |
|
|
|
<li data-value="5">我的日志</li> |
|
|
|
@if (ViewBag.UserType == "学生") |
|
|
@@ -382,8 +382,7 @@ |
|
|
|
<li>出生日期 : {{teacherInfo.Birthday | date}}</li> |
|
|
|
<li>联系电话 : {{teacherInfo.mobile}}</li> |
|
|
|
<li>校 区 : {{baseInfo.companyId | company}}</li> |
|
|
|
<li>教职工类别 : {{teacherInfo.EmpSortNo | empSortNo}}</li> |
|
|
|
<li>聘任职称 : {{teacherInfo.TitleOfTechPostNo | titleOfTechPostNo}}</li> |
|
|
|
<li>部门 : {{teacherInfo.F_DepartmentId | department}}</li> |
|
|
|
</ul> |
|
|
|
</div> |
|
|
|
</div> |
|
|
@@ -396,41 +395,39 @@ |
|
|
|
<li>民 族 : {{teacherInfo.NationalityNo | nationalityNo}}</li> |
|
|
|
<li>政治面貌 : {{teacherInfo.PartyFaceNo | partyFaceNo}}</li> |
|
|
|
<li>身份证号 : {{teacherInfo.IdentityCardNo}} </li> |
|
|
|
<li>E-mail : {{teacherInfo.EMail}}</li> |
|
|
|
<li>健康状况 : {{teacherInfo.HealthStatusNo | healthStatusNo}}</li> |
|
|
|
<li>档案所在地 : {{teacherInfo.LocusOfArchives}} </li> |
|
|
|
<li>户口所在地 : {{teacherInfo.LocusOfResidence}} </li> |
|
|
|
</ul> |
|
|
|
</div> |
|
|
|
|
|
|
|
<div class="userSec2Box"> |
|
|
|
<div class="userSec2T">家庭情况 <i class="fa fa-angle-right"></i></div> |
|
|
|
<div class="userSec2T">学历学位信息 <i class="fa fa-angle-right"></i></div> |
|
|
|
<ul class="userSec2List"> |
|
|
|
<li>港澳台侨 : {{teacherInfo.OverseasChineseNo | overseasChineseNo}} </li> |
|
|
|
<li>健康状况 : {{teacherInfo.HealthStatusNo | healthStatusNo}}</li> |
|
|
|
<li>家庭出身 : {{teacherInfo.FamilyOriginNo | familyOriginNo}} </li> |
|
|
|
<li>外语语种 : {{teacherInfo.ForeignLanguageNo | foreignLanguageNo}} </li> |
|
|
|
<li>户籍省份 : {{teacherInfo.ProvinceNo | provinceNo}} </li> |
|
|
|
<li>户籍地市 : {{teacherInfo.CityNo | cityNo}} </li> |
|
|
|
<li>户籍县区 : {{teacherInfo.RegionNo | regionNo}} </li> |
|
|
|
<li>最高学历 : {{teacherInfo.HighestRecord | HighestRecordNo}} </li> |
|
|
|
<li>获取方式 : {{teacherInfo.ObtainWayOfHighestRecord | ObtainWayNo}} </li> |
|
|
|
<li>取得时间 : {{teacherInfo.HighestRecordGetTime}} </li> |
|
|
|
<li>最高学位 : {{teacherInfo.DegreeNo | degreeNo}}</li> |
|
|
|
<li>获取方式 : {{teacherInfo.ObtainWayOfHighestDegree | ObtainWayOfHighestDegreeNo}} </li> |
|
|
|
<li>取得时间 : {{teacherInfo.HighestDegreeGetTime}} </li> |
|
|
|
</ul> |
|
|
|
</div> |
|
|
|
|
|
|
|
<div class="userSec2Box"> |
|
|
|
<div class="userSec2T">其他 <i class="fa fa-angle-right"></i></div> |
|
|
|
<div class="userSec2T">其他信息 <i class="fa fa-angle-right"></i></div> |
|
|
|
<ul class="userSec2List"> |
|
|
|
<li>学科门 : {{teacherInfo.SubjectSpeciesNo | subjectSpeciesNo}}</li> |
|
|
|
<li>现任职务: {{teacherInfo.Title}}</li> |
|
|
|
<li>所在系部 : {{teacherInfo.DeptNo | deptNo}} </li> |
|
|
|
<li>文化程度 : {{teacherInfo.CultureDegreeNo | cultureDegreeNo}} </li> |
|
|
|
<li>毕业学校 : {{teacherInfo.GraduateSchoolName}} </li> |
|
|
|
<li>最高学位 : {{teacherInfo.DegreeNo | degreeNo}}</li> |
|
|
|
<li>来校年月 : {{teacherInfo.InSchoolDate | date}}</li> |
|
|
|
<li>毕业时间 : {{teacherInfo.GraduateDate1}} </li> |
|
|
|
<li>是否代课 : {{teacherInfo.IsHasLesson | IsHasLessonNo}}</li> |
|
|
|
<li>文化程度 : {{teacherInfo.CultureDegreeNo | cultureDegreeNo}} </li> |
|
|
|
<li>现任职务: {{teacherInfo.Title}}</li> |
|
|
|
</ul> |
|
|
|
</div> |
|
|
|
|
|
|
|
<div class="userSec2Box"> |
|
|
|
<div class="userSec2T">联系方式 <i class="fa fa-angle-right"></i></div> |
|
|
|
<ul class="userSec2List"> |
|
|
|
<li>手机号码 : {{teacherInfo.mobile}}</li> |
|
|
|
<li>紧急联系人 : {{teacherInfo.Linkman}}</li> |
|
|
|
<li>紧急联系人电话 : {{teacherInfo.PhoneOfLinkman}}</li> |
|
|
|
</ul> |
|
|
@@ -452,8 +449,6 @@ |
|
|
|
$.get('/UserCenter/GetTeacherInfo', function (ref) { |
|
|
|
this.teacherInfo = ref.data.userInfo; |
|
|
|
this.baseInfo = ref.data.basecInfo; |
|
|
|
console.log(ref); |
|
|
|
|
|
|
|
}.bind(this), "json"); |
|
|
|
}, |
|
|
|
getUrl: function () { |
|
|
@@ -485,6 +480,19 @@ |
|
|
|
}); |
|
|
|
return result; |
|
|
|
}, |
|
|
|
department: function (value) { |
|
|
|
var result; |
|
|
|
top.learun.clientdata.getAsync('custmerData', { |
|
|
|
sync: true, |
|
|
|
url: '/LR_SystemModule/DataSource/GetDataTable?code=' + 'classdata', |
|
|
|
key: value, |
|
|
|
keyId: 'f_departmentid', |
|
|
|
callback: function (_data) { |
|
|
|
result = _data.f_fullname; |
|
|
|
} |
|
|
|
}); |
|
|
|
return result; |
|
|
|
}, |
|
|
|
nationalityNo: function (value) { |
|
|
|
var result; |
|
|
|
top.learun.clientdata.getAsync('custmerData', { |
|
|
@@ -511,15 +519,15 @@ |
|
|
|
}); |
|
|
|
return result; |
|
|
|
}, |
|
|
|
overseasChineseNo: function (value) { |
|
|
|
HighestRecordNo: function (value) { |
|
|
|
var result; |
|
|
|
top.learun.clientdata.getAsync('custmerData', { |
|
|
|
sync: true, |
|
|
|
url: '/LR_SystemModule/DataSource/GetDataTable?code=' + 'BCdOverseasChinese', |
|
|
|
url: '/LR_SystemModule/DataSource/GetDataTable?code=' + 'BCdCultureDegree', |
|
|
|
key: value, |
|
|
|
keyId: 'overseaschineseno', |
|
|
|
keyId: 'culturedegreeno', |
|
|
|
callback: function (_data) { |
|
|
|
result = _data.overseaschinesename; |
|
|
|
result = _data.culturedegree; |
|
|
|
} |
|
|
|
}); |
|
|
|
|
|
|
@@ -575,15 +583,14 @@ |
|
|
|
}); |
|
|
|
return result; |
|
|
|
}, |
|
|
|
foreignLanguageNo: function (value) { |
|
|
|
ObtainWayNo: function (value) { |
|
|
|
var result; |
|
|
|
top.learun.clientdata.getAsync('custmerData', { |
|
|
|
url: '/LR_SystemModule/DataSource/GetDataTable?code=' + 'BCdForeignLanguage', |
|
|
|
top.learun.clientdata.getAsync('dataItem', { |
|
|
|
key: value, |
|
|
|
keyId: 'foreignlanguageno', |
|
|
|
code: 'ObtainWay', |
|
|
|
callback: function (_data) { |
|
|
|
result = _data.foreignlanguagename; |
|
|
|
}.bind(this) |
|
|
|
result = _data.text; |
|
|
|
} |
|
|
|
}); |
|
|
|
return result; |
|
|
|
}, |
|
|
@@ -652,6 +659,17 @@ |
|
|
|
}); |
|
|
|
return result; |
|
|
|
}, |
|
|
|
ObtainWayOfHighestDegreeNo: function (value) { |
|
|
|
var result; |
|
|
|
top.learun.clientdata.getAsync('dataItem', { |
|
|
|
key: value, |
|
|
|
code: 'ObtainWayOfDegree', |
|
|
|
callback: function (_data) { |
|
|
|
result = _data.text; |
|
|
|
} |
|
|
|
}); |
|
|
|
return result; |
|
|
|
}, |
|
|
|
empSortNo: function (value) { |
|
|
|
var result; |
|
|
|
top.learun.clientdata.getAsync('dataItem', { |
|
|
@@ -675,6 +693,17 @@ |
|
|
|
} |
|
|
|
}); |
|
|
|
return result; |
|
|
|
}, |
|
|
|
IsHasLessonNo: function (value) { |
|
|
|
var result; |
|
|
|
top.learun.clientdata.getAsync('dataItem', { |
|
|
|
key: value, |
|
|
|
code: 'YesOrNoBit', |
|
|
|
callback: function (_data) { |
|
|
|
result = _data.text; |
|
|
|
} |
|
|
|
}); |
|
|
|
return result; |
|
|
|
} |
|
|
|
} |
|
|
|
|
|
|
@@ -756,7 +785,7 @@ |
|
|
|
|
|
|
|
$(function () { |
|
|
|
var loginInfo = top.learun.clientdata.get(['userinfo']); |
|
|
|
$("#headUrl").attr("src", "/LR_OrganizationModule/User/GetImg?userId=" + loginInfo.userId); |
|
|
|
$("#headUrl").attr("src", "/LR_OrganizationModule/User/GetImgForDC?userId=" + loginInfo.userId); |
|
|
|
|
|
|
|
if ('@ViewBag.UserType' == '学生') { |
|
|
|
$("#lr_left_list").children('li').eq(4).addClass("active"); |
|
|
@@ -796,4 +825,4 @@ |
|
|
|
} |
|
|
|
}); |
|
|
|
</script> |
|
|
|
@Html.AppendJsFile("/Views/UserCenter/Index.js") |
|
|
|
@Html.AppendJsFile("/Views/UserCenter/IndexForDC.js") |